Subject: FD leak hunt — need your eyes

Hey Brightmoor integration folks,

We're still chasing that leaked file descriptor in the Quillhook sync bridge. Every time your webhook retries, our proxy opens a socket that never closes, and after a few hours the Varnholt node tips over. Could you run the diagnostic capture on your staging side and post the lsof dump? To pull traces from our debug endpoint, authenticate with the token below.

session JWT of yawep-yawep = eyJhbGciOiJIUzI1NiIsInR5cCI6IkpXVCJ9.eyJzdWIiOiI3pWF3_In0.aXYsHiog

Hey team — if gate counts from the Dunmire Arena turnstiles look frozen, the Gatewick counter service probably dropped its feed. First, restart the collector from the admin panel, then confirm new ticks appear within a minute. Still flat? Escalate to platform. To pull raw counts yourself, call the counter API with the key below.

API key for yahig-tadup: kto7_ubizbYm

To the release manager: I'm passing ownership of the Pellwick deep-link router to Sorrel before the 4.2 cut. The intent-matching table now lives in the Farrowgate config service; stale entries were purged last sprint. Watch the fallback route — it silently swallows malformed slugs, which inflated our drop-off metrics in March. The staging resolver needs its keystore unlocked before each regression pass, and that keystore accepts only one credential. For the signing vault, the recovery phrase is noted directly below.

recovery phrase for tafog-fafog: novix-novdor-fraath-brieth-olieth-oliix-rusix-wenion-julax-druox

## Squatseek — Environments

Quick tour for the security review: Squatseek, our typo-squatting package scanner, runs in three environments — dev, staging, and prod. Dev uses a mirrored registry snapshot, staging hits the real feed read-only, and prod is the only one allowed to file takedown tickets. Each environment's behavior is driven entirely by the values below.

config for yajep-tafof:
[rusath]
team = julmir
access_code = ac_fe37fd
host = rusath.novactech.test
port = 8000
owner = pelmir.weneth
peer = oliwyn.olvarqdyn.internal